Output 028437feba7584e133b4c9a44c20224d89e33a33bfbf6a72f472355cff42f72a:1

value
76615239
script pubkey
OP_HASH160 OP_PUSHBYTES_20 521db4e0652301cfa75eaa0e91fc4dd457a63dc7 OP_EQUAL
address
MFPMECzFpULDEHM4dNuzfnHn4kwryECRf5
transaction
028437feba7584e133b4c9a44c20224d89e33a33bfbf6a72f472355cff42f72a
spent
true